'''Asha Jushu Davar''' is a [[lighteyes|lighteyed]] [[Veden]] on [[Roshar]]. He is the fourth son of [[Shallan's mother|Brightness Davar]] and [[Lin Davar]].{{book ref|sa1|i|2}}{{book ref|sa1|33}}
His siblings are [[Helaran Davar|Helaran]], [[Balat Davar|Balat]], his older twin [[Wikim Davar|Wikim]], and [[Shallan Davar|Shallan]].

Jushu was a happy, smiling child, and as he grew up he remained quicker to laugh than his twin.{{book ref|sa4|13}} Even in his darkest moments, he will engage in gallows humor with [[Shallan]] as a coping mechanism.{{book ref|sa2|48}}{{book ref|sa4|13}}
 
Jushu has problems with addiction; [[Balat]] believes he was driven to vice by years of suffering [[Lin Davar|their father]]’s brutal temper.{{book ref|sa1|i|2}} Shallan also thinks Jushu is a good man that could not be blamed for his vices.{{book ref|sa2|27}} He is addicted to gambling, and will wager anything available to him, including any gemstones in his clothing.{{book ref|sa2|27}} His addiction causes him to lie and steal in order to get money or credit to fund his gambling,{{book ref|sa2|61}}{{book ref|sa4|13}} although he has been able to restrain himself somewhat in order to help his family.{{book ref|sa1|29}} He drinks wine heavily, especially while gambling,{{book ref|sa2|27}} and is also seen rubbing a plant between his fingers which is likely highly addictive [[firemoss]].{{book ref|sa2|73}} Wikim believes that Jushu will inevitably destroy himself.{{book ref|sa2|45}}
 
== Attributes and Abilities ==
Jushu likes duels and wishes he could participate in them. [[Shallan]] has a fantasy in which she sees [[Helaran]] sparring with Jushu and teaching him swordsmanship, but it is not clear if this ever happened in reality.{{book ref|sa2|45}}
 
He has some understanding of the political machinations among [[Veden]] [[lighteyes]].{{book ref|sa2|39}}

===Early Life===
Jushu was born as Van Jushu, the youngest of the Davar brothers; he and [[Wikim]] are fifteen months older than Shallan.{{book ref|sa2|45}} Little is known of his youth, but he felt that his father always favored [[Helaran]] and [[Shallan]] over his other children, and recounted that [[Lin]] only ever had curses for him. Jushu was subjected to many fits of Lin's temper, and was bitter towards his father.{{book ref|sa2|27}}{{book ref|sa1|i|2}}
 
Jushu believed the cover-up story that Shallan had seen Lin kill [[Shallan's mother|his wife]], Jushu's mother.{{book ref|sa2|27}} He was not aware of the true sequence of events, and was the person that comforted Shallan on the night of their mother's death.{{book ref|sa2|48}} His father soon remarried, and [[Malise Gevelmar]] became his stepmother.{{book ref|sa1|5}}
 
As Jushu became a teenager, Lin's anger and neglect took its toll, and Jushu began gambling and drinking heavily. Around {{Rosharan date|1168}}, he showed up drunk to a feast held by Lin for other lighteyes, which was sure to anger Lin. He was present when Shallan saw her mother's "soul" in a strongbox, athoughalthough he could not see anything.{{book ref|sa2|27}} About a year later, he attended another feast at the Davar estate, and engaged in some friendly banter with his siblings. After [[Redin]] interrupted the feast seeking someone to testify against Lin, Jushu seemed to consider it, but quickly lost his nerve.{{book ref|sa2|39}}

===Move to Urithiru===
As historic events began occurring across [[Roshar]], Shallan felt guilty about abandoning her brothers. She lost contact with them after losing her [[spanreed]] on the ''[[Wind's Pleasure]]'' and became increasingly worried after learning of the [[Veden civil war]].{{book ref|sa2|31}} After [[Urithiru]] was discovered, she wrote them a number of letters telling them to come live with her there, but she did not receive any response.{{book ref|sa2|60}} Shallan eventually learned from [[Mraize]] that the Davar lands had fallen and that he was bringing her family to Urithiru; her service to the Ghostbloods as Veil would fulfill the debt of the broken Soulcaster.{{book ref|sa2|88}}
 
Mraize fulfilled his promise and Jushu, Wikim, Balat, and Eylita arrived in Urithiru after the [[Battle of Thaylen Field]]. Jushu's clothes were worn and he had lost some weight. The family reunited with Shallan and attended her wedding to [[Adolin Kholin]].{{book ref|sa3|122}}
 
Jushu and his brothers were given quarters near Shallan's in Urithiru. Shallan visited often, but she felt some regret about the way that she perceived Jushu and the rest of her family after having changed so much since leaving her childhood home. Jushu had to be watched constantly to ensure that he did not steal things and pawn them for gambling money. He unknowingly befriended Mraize, who was posing as a guardsman named Gobby.{{book ref|sa4|13}}
 
== Relationships ==
 
=== Shallan ===
Shallan believes that Jushu harbors some resentment towards her due to Lin's favoritism,{{book ref|sa2|39}} although he does not seem to lash out at her. He usually laughs at her jokes, even if they are not that funny.{{book ref|sa2|39}}{{book ref|sa3|44}} Shallan never forgets that Jushu held her on the night that their mother died.{{book ref|sa2|48}} She cares for Jushu, and she believes that he is a good man that was broken by Lin's actions.{{book ref|sa2|39}} She tries to distract him from gambling by suggesting that he watch duels instead, since she knows that he is interested in swordplay.{{book ref|sa2|45}} She often thinks about Jushu and her other brothers after leaving Jah Keved and she feels responsible for them.{{book ref|sa1|33}} After Lin's death, Jushu and Shallan no longer bond over defying him, and Shallan worries that they could drift apart. However, she does not fully trust Jushu due to his ongoing addictions, and cannot always tell if he is being genuine. They still attempt some banter, but their interactions become more awkward.{{book ref|sa4|13}}
